Geographic Information Systems I
GEOG 508 - Class Number: 16212



Description:
Examination of the major theories, concepts, and operations in geographic information systems (GIS). Topics include: the structure of geographic data models, geographic data acquisition, spatial database management, data processing methods. Vector and raster GIS operations, and general approaches to GIS-based spatial modeling.
- Students must have access to a Windows computer that meets the following requirements https://pro.arcgis.com/en/pro-app/latest/get-started/arcgis-pro-system-requirements.htm. MAC, tablets and Chromebook cannot operate the required program used for exercises.
